What is used as CO2 absorber in anesthesia machine?

Anesthesia Delivery Systems Soda lime granules consist of calcium hydroxide, water, and small amounts of the strong bases sodium hydroxide (NaOH) and potassium hydroxide (KOH) that serve as catalysts for carbon dioxide absorption (Table 15.3).

How do you flush anesthesia for malignant hyperthermia?

Abstract. Anaesthetic machines are prepared for use with patients who are susceptible to malignant hyperpyrexia (MH) by flushing with oxygen at 10 l/min for ten minutes to reduce the anaesthetic concentration to 1 part per million (ppm) or less.

What is paw on anesthesia machine?

Paw is airway pressure, PIP is peak airway pressure, Pplat is plateau pressure. Some researchers have suggested that plateau pressures should be monitored as a means to prevent barotrauma in the patient with ARDS. Plateau pressures are measured at the end of the inspiratory phase of a ventilator-cycled tidal volume.

What is Bain circuit?

The Bain circuit is a “coaxial” Mapleson D- the same components, but the fresh gas flow tubing is directed within the inspiratory limb, with fresh gas entering the circuit near the mask. Fresh gas flow requirements are similar to other NRB circuits.

Why soda lime is used in Anaesthesia machine?

Soda lime is a mixture of NaOH & CaO chemicals, used in granular form in closed breathing environments, such as general anaesthesia, submarines, rebreathers and recompression chambers, to remove carbon dioxide from breathing gases to prevent CO2 retention and carbon dioxide poisoning.

Why is CO2 used in anesthesia?

CO2 absorbents were introduced into anesthesia practice in 1924 and are essential when using a circle system to minimize waste by reducing fresh gas flow to allow exhaled anesthetic agents to be rebreathed.

What is the antidote for malignant hyperthermia?

DANTROLENE We recommend administration of dantrolene as soon as MH is suspected, as dantrolene is the only known antidote for MH.

Who invented Bain circuit?

The Bain circuit: a coaxial modification of the Mapleson D type circuit (1972) The well-known coaxial breathing circuit was introduced by Bain and Spoerel in 1972 [5].

What is the pH of soda lime?

13.5
6. Soda lime consists of 94% calcium hydroxide and 5% sodium hydroxide with a small amount of potassium hydroxide (less than 0.1%). It has a pH of 13.5 and a moisture content of 14–19%.

How much CO2 can soda lime absorb?

Soda lime absorbs about 19% of its weight in carbon dioxide, hence 100 g of soda lime can absorb approximately 26 L of carbon dioxide.

What is CO2 absorber?

A carbon dioxide scrubber is a piece of equipment that absorbs carbon dioxide (CO2). It is used to treat exhaust gases from industrial plants or from exhaled air in life support systems such as rebreathers or in spacecraft, submersible craft or airtight chambers.
